Listen "How Do We Power the Developing World?"
Episode Synopsis
Providing modern energy services to the developing world is a monumental challenge, as 80% of the global population resides in these regions yet uses only 20% of the world's energy. This episode features a discussion between Ashvin Dayal from The Rockefeller Foundation and Robert Stoner, Deputy Director at the MIT Energy Initiative, on how to potentially double global energy production to meet this demand. They explore strategies for increasing energy access affordably while minimizing environmental impacts.
